Trump’s Strategic Leverage in Russia-Ukraine Conflict

Former President Trump’s unique position in the Russia-Ukraine conflict stems from his complex relationships with both Moscow and Kyiv, which provide him with strategic leverage not easily accessible to current U.S. policymakers. His approach to diplomacy, punctuated by direct communication with Vladimir Putin and a history of skepticism towards NATO’s expansion, creates openings for alternative negotiation frameworks. Key aspects of this leverage include:

  • Established rapport with Russian leadership: Maintaining lines of communication that transcend official channels.
  • Fluctuating support within U.S. political factions: Commanding loyalty from segments advocating for a recalibrated foreign policy.
  • Capacity to influence public opinion: Leveraging his platform to shift narratives surrounding conflict resolution.

The potential for Trump to act as a peace broker is underscored by competing interests within Washington, as well as the war-weariness evident among global observers. Potential Diplomatic Pathways for Immediate Ceasefire

Exploring avenues to halt hostilities demands a multifaceted approach centered on genuine dialogue and trust-building. One viable option involves re-engaging key international stakeholders who have maintained communication channels with Moscow and Kyiv, leveraging their influence to pressure both parties towards an immediate ceasefire. This includes renewed calls for back-channel negotiations that prioritize de-escalation and humanitarian corridors, coupled with transparent monitoring mechanisms to ensure compliance.

Key diplomatic tools to consider:

  • Multilateral mediation: Empowering neutral actors such as the United Nations or the Organization for Security and Co-operation in Europe (OSCE) to facilitate dialogue.
  • Targeted sanctions relief: Offering phased economic incentives contingent on concrete steps towards cessation of violence.
  • Inclusive peace forums: Incorporating representatives from affected regions to foster legitimacy and grassroots support.
  • Confidence-building measures: Temporary ceasefires for humanitarian aid distribution, establishing trust for broader agreements.

Urgent Steps for Washington to Support Peace Initiatives

Washington’s role in de-escalating the Russia-Ukraine conflict must evolve from rhetorical support to decisive action. Immediate engagement in back-channel diplomacy, coupled with a calibrated approach to sanctions relief, could incentivize both parties toward meaningful dialogue. The U.S. administration should prioritize empowering neutral mediators and facilitate humanitarian corridors as tangible demonstrations of commitment to peace.

Key measures to consider include:

  • Initiating direct talks with Russian officials under international oversight.
  • Extending humanitarian aid with transparent monitoring mechanisms.
  • Reevaluating punitive measures that disproportionately affect civilian populations.
